Konuyu Paylaş : facebook gplus twitter

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 1
  • 2
  • 3
  • 4
  • 5
Delphi cxGrid'e İlişkili Tabloda Veri Gösterme?
#1
Merhabalar, belki programlarımda ilişkili tablo hiç kullanmadım desem yeridir, fakat merak ettim bu meseleyi. Biraz araştırma yaptım SQL Server'da tablo ilişkilendirmenin nasıl olduğunu vs. 

Bunlar tamam anladım dedim fakat şöyle bir şey aklıma takıldı. Düşünelim ki benim 3 tablom var, iki tanesi detail bir tanesi master table olsun. İki detail tablodan ben gerekli ID'leri tabloma aktardım. master tablom da sadece ID değerleri mevcut oldu. Sorum şu;


 Ben o ID değerleri yerine detail tablom da ki verileri nasıl cxGrid'e çekebilirim?


Eğer sorumu anlatırken yanlış anlatmışsam şu şekilde;

XXgMA6.png
NOT: Resim bir videodan alıntıdır.

  İşte burda ID'ler girildi ama ilişkili tabloların ID'leri bunu ben gride select ile çektiğimde önüme belli ki ID'ler gelecek. Bunu ben tüm veriler için nasıl string değerlerini talep edeceğim?



Yardımcı olanlara şimdiden çok teşekkürler  Rolleyes
Linkleri Görebilmeniz İçin Giriş yap veya Üye Ol
Cevapla
#2
tablolar arasındaki ilişki master-detail mi? yoksa lookup tarzı mı?
sanki senin istediğin master-detail değil de lookup tarzı
select cümlesinde tablonu join ile diğer tablolara bağlayıp listele yapabilirsin
Cevapla
#3
(04-08-2017, Saat: 22:14)meko Adlı Kullanıcıdan Alıntı: Linkleri Görebilmeniz İçin Giriş yap veya Üye Oltablolar arasındaki ilişki master-detail mi? yoksa lookup tarzı mı?
sanki senin istediğin master-detail değil de lookup tarzı
select cümlesinde tablonu join ile diğer tablolara bağlayıp listele yapabilirsin

 Aslında hocam dediğiniz gibi lookup tarzı oluyor. Join komutunu deneyeyim. Teşekkürler Smile
Linkleri Görebilmeniz İçin Giriş yap veya Üye Ol
Cevapla
#4
cxGrid de master detail özelliğini kullanın.
Master ve Detail olan queryleri gösterip kullanabiliyorsunuz.
Cevapla
#5
(04-08-2017, Saat: 23:26)FiRewaLL Adlı Kullanıcıdan Alıntı: Linkleri Görebilmeniz İçin Giriş yap veya Üye OlcxGrid de master detail özelliğini kullanın.
Master ve Detail olan queryleri gösterip kullanabiliyorsunuz.

   Teşekkürler hocam onuda deneyeyim Smile
Linkleri Görebilmeniz İçin Giriş yap veya Üye Ol
Cevapla
#6
master-detail ilişkisi biraz yavaşlatabilir.. hatta hatta datanız büyük ise süründürür. en iyisi sql join. Wink
sonuçta cxgrid e bağladığınız query nesnesinden dönen sonucu cxgrid gösterir. siz en iyisi joinleyin Smile
WWW
Cevapla

Konuyu Paylaş : facebook gplus twitter



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
  delphi ile web servis yazmak. Kamuran Alpkaya 4 1.158 20-09-2018, Saat: 18:08
Son Yorum: Bay_Y
  Veri Tabanı Bağlantı Yöntemi emrahgs 6 259 12-09-2018, Saat: 18:24
Son Yorum: emrahgs
Question OpenSSL .dll sorunu delphi 10.2 BY-HAYALET 5 404 12-09-2018, Saat: 17:08
Son Yorum: uparlayan
  Visual Studio Code for Delphi gjamesbond 1 109 11-09-2018, Saat: 10:19
Son Yorum: Fesih ARSLAN
  Delphi içinden ve MSSQL üzerinden storeprocedure çalıştırma Bay_Y 6 247 30-08-2018, Saat: 13:10
Son Yorum: Bay_Y



Konuyu Okuyanlar: 1 Ziyaretçi